#0fc182 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0fc182 is composed of 5.9% red, 75.7%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.6%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 158.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 40.8%. #0fc182 color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#008305.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#0fc182 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0fc182 has RGB values of R:15, G:193,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1032578.

Shades and Tints of #0fc182
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b07 is the darkest color, while #f8fefc is the lightest one.
